Lee Greenwood happy with quality in Dewsbury Rams squad for 2021
Dewsbury won three of their four Championship fixtures, including fine victories over Halifax and Widnes Vikings, before the season was cut short due to the coronavirus pandemic.
After retaining the majority of their squad and bringing in a handful of new faces, Greenwood feels his squad is in good shape for next year.

“We said very early on we didn’t need to change a lot. All the players who were contracted to us for 2020 were offered deals,” said Greenwood.
“Some chose to not take it up and move on. However most have stayed and we’ve managed to bring a few more in. There are still a few positions I’m keeping my eye on, but quality wise as I said I think we are as strong if not stronger for 2021.
“To the guys who have moved on, I’d just like to place on record my thanks to them.
